Abstract
This paper proposes a new pattern recognition algorithm that is applied to determine rings in two-dimensional spectra from RICH detectors. It defines a two-dimensional boosted Gold deconvolution algorithm. This paper also thoroughly analyzes and studies the influence of input parameters for different kinds of data. By choosing suitable input parameters for deconvolution one can obtain an efficient tool for identifying rings in two-dimensional spectra. Illustrative examples prove in favor of the proposed algorithm.
